Why Do Some Smart Lights Fail To Sync With Voice Assistants

Smart lighting systems promise convenience, ambiance, and energy efficiency—all controllable with a simple voice command. Yet many users encounter a frustrating reality: their smart bulbs won’t connect to Alexa, Google Assistant, or Siri. Despite following setup instructions, the lights remain unresponsive or appear offline. This isn't always due to user error. Behind the scenes, a complex interplay of hardware compatibility, network stability, and software integration determines whether your smart lights work as intended.

Understanding why synchronization fails is the first step toward resolving it. From outdated firmware to conflicting protocols, numerous technical and environmental factors can disrupt communication between smart lights and voice assistants. More than just troubleshooting steps are needed—users require insight into how these systems interact and what conditions enable reliable performance.

Common Technical Reasons for Sync Failures

At the core of most sync issues lie technical incompatibilities. Unlike traditional bulbs, smart lights rely on wireless communication protocols such as Wi-Fi, Zigbee, Z-Wave, or Bluetooth. Each protocol has distinct strengths and limitations that affect how well they interface with voice-controlled platforms.

Wi-Fi-based smart lights connect directly to your home network, making them accessible over the internet. However, this also means they're vulnerable to bandwidth congestion, especially in homes with multiple connected devices. If your router struggles to maintain stable connections, smart lights may drop off the network or fail to register commands from voice assistants.

Zigbee and Z-Wave lights require a hub—a central device that acts as a bridge between the bulbs and your voice assistant. Without a properly configured hub, even compatible lights will not appear in your Alexa or Google Home app. A common mistake is assuming plug-and-play functionality when, in fact, the hub must be linked to both the lighting system and the assistant platform.

Bluetooth-only bulbs have limited range and typically only work when your smartphone or assistant device is within close proximity. These often fail to sync reliably if you're trying to control them from another room or through an app that doesn’t support direct pairing.

Tip: Always verify that your smart light uses a protocol supported by your preferred voice assistant before purchasing.

Protocol Compatibility by Voice Assistant

Protocol Alexa Support Google Assistant Support Apple HomeKit Support
Wi-Fi (2.4 GHz) Yes Yes Limited (requires certified devices)
Zigbee Yes (via Echo Plus or separate hub) Yes (via Nest Hub or third-party hub) No (unless bridged via HomeKit-compatible hub)
Z-Wave Yes (with compatible hub) Limited (via select hubs) No
Bluetooth Yes (short-range only) Yes (for nearby control) Yes (with HomePod mini or later)

The table highlights a critical point: compatibility isn’t universal. A bulb that works flawlessly with Alexa may not function at all with Google Assistant unless specific ecosystem requirements are met.

Network and Connectivity Challenges

Even with the right protocol, poor network performance remains one of the leading causes of sync failure. Smart lights depend on consistent two-way communication: receiving commands from the assistant and sending status updates back to the cloud.

Issues arise when Wi-Fi signal strength is weak in areas where lights are installed. Basements, garages, or rooms far from the router often suffer from low signal quality. In such cases, the bulb may connect initially but drop out during use, causing it to appear \"unreachable\" in the app.

Interference from other electronic devices—microwaves, cordless phones, baby monitors—can also degrade 2.4 GHz Wi-Fi performance, which most smart lights rely on. Additionally, dual-band routers that merge 2.4 GHz and 5 GHz networks under a single SSID can confuse devices. Since smart lights cannot operate on 5 GHz, they may attempt to connect to the wrong band and fail silently.

“Over 60% of smart home device issues stem from suboptimal Wi-Fi conditions rather than faulty hardware.” — Rajiv Mehta, Senior Network Engineer at SmartHome Labs

To ensure reliable connectivity:

  • Use a dedicated 2.4 GHz network with a unique SSID.
  • Position your router centrally or install mesh extenders in dead zones.
  • Limit the number of active devices on the same network.
  • Ensure your router firmware is up to date.

Firmware, Software, and Ecosystem Gaps

Synchronization depends heavily on software alignment across multiple layers: the light’s firmware, the companion app, the hub (if applicable), and the voice assistant platform. When any component falls behind in updates, communication breaks down.

Manufacturers regularly release firmware updates to improve stability, add features, and patch security vulnerabilities. However, many users never manually check for updates, and automatic updates aren’t always enabled. An outdated bulb might lack support for newer API changes introduced by Alexa or Google, resulting in failed discovery or erratic behavior.

App misconfigurations are equally problematic. During setup, users must link their lighting account (e.g., Philips Hue, LIFX, or TP-Link Kasa) to the voice assistant service. If this integration is interrupted or revoked—such as after a password change or app reinstall—the assistant loses access to the lights, even though they continue working locally.

Ecosystem fragmentation further complicates matters. While major brands like Philips Hue and Nanoleaf maintain strong partnerships with Amazon and Google, smaller or budget-friendly brands may offer incomplete or delayed integration. Some lights claim “Alexa compatible” but only support basic on/off functions, lacking dimming or color control through voice.

Mini Case Study: The Unresponsive Living Room Bulbs

Sarah purchased a set of popular Wi-Fi smart bulbs advertised as compatible with Google Assistant. After installation, she could control them via the brand’s mobile app but couldn’t get them to respond to her Nest Hub. She tried resetting the bulbs, reinstalled the app, and even factory-reset the hub—nothing worked.

Upon closer inspection, she discovered that while the bulbs were technically compatible, they required a firmware update to enable full Google integration. The update wasn’t pushed automatically. Only after manually checking the manufacturer’s website and forcing an update did the bulbs appear in the Google Home app and respond to voice commands.

This case illustrates how easily a minor software gap can mimic a complete sync failure—even when all hardware is functioning correctly.

Step-by-Step Guide to Fix Sync Issues

If your smart lights aren’t responding to voice commands, follow this systematic approach to identify and resolve the root cause.

  1. Verify Device Compatibility: Confirm that your smart light model is officially supported by your voice assistant. Check the manufacturer’s website or the assistant’s device directory.
  2. Check Network Connection: Ensure the bulb is connected to a 2.4 GHz Wi-Fi network. Use a Wi-Fi analyzer app to confirm signal strength near the fixture.
  3. Reconnect the Service Link: Open your voice assistant app (e.g., Alexa or Google Home), go to Account Settings > Connected Services, and relink the lighting platform. Follow prompts to reauthorize access.
  4. Update Firmware: Access the lighting app and check for available firmware updates. Install them even if the bulbs seem to be working normally.
  5. Restart Devices: Power cycle the router, voice assistant device (Echo, Home, etc.), and smart bulbs. Wait two minutes between restarts to allow services to stabilize.
  6. Re-discover Devices: In the voice assistant app, initiate a new device search. This forces the system to scan for newly added or previously missed lights.
  7. Test with Alternative Commands: Try different phrasings (“Turn on the living room light” vs. “Switch on the overhead”). Sometimes naming conflicts or ambiguous room labels prevent recognition.
Tip: Assign clear, unique names to your lights and avoid generic terms like “lamp” or “light.” Use descriptive names like “Kitchen Pendant Light” to reduce voice recognition errors.

Prevention Checklist: Ensuring Long-Term Sync Stability

Maintaining consistent performance requires proactive care. Use this checklist to minimize future sync problems:

  • ✅ Enable automatic firmware updates in your lighting app.
  • ✅ Label lights clearly and assign them to correct rooms in the assistant app.
  • ✅ Use a mesh Wi-Fi system to eliminate dead zones.
  • ✅ Avoid overcrowding your network with too many IoT devices.
  • ✅ Periodically review connected services and reauthenticate if needed.
  • ✅ Keep your router’s firmware updated to support modern IoT standards.
  • ✅ Choose reputable brands with proven track records in voice assistant integration.

Frequently Asked Questions

Why does Alexa find my smart lights sometimes but not others?

This usually indicates inconsistent network coverage or incomplete setup. Lights in distant rooms may struggle to maintain a connection. It can also happen if some bulbs haven’t been fully registered in the lighting app before discovery. Always complete setup in the manufacturer’s app first, then initiate a device search in Alexa.

Can I use smart lights with multiple voice assistants?

Yes, but with caveats. You can link the same lighting account to both Alexa and Google Assistant, allowing control through either. However, avoid assigning the same physical light to both ecosystems simultaneously, as this can create command conflicts and unexpected behavior. Stick to one primary assistant per device group for best results.

My smart lights work in the app but not by voice. What should I do?

This points to a service linking issue. Even if the lights are online, the voice assistant may have lost permission to access them. Go to your assistant’s settings, disconnect the lighting service, then reconnect it. Also, ensure the lights are not grouped under a scene or routine that restricts voice access.
